数据库列的数目是什么
-
数据库列的数目是指在数据库表中的每一行中,所包含的列的数量。每个列都代表着表中的一个特定属性或数据字段。数据库列的数目取决于表的设计和需求,可以是任意数量。
下面是关于数据库列数目的一些重要点:
-
数据库表的列数目是根据实际需求进行设计的。在设计数据库表时,需要明确每个列所代表的数据类型和含义,以便正确地存储和管理数据。
-
列数目的多少取决于表的设计目的和数据模型。不同类型的表可能具有不同数量的列。例如,一个学生信息表可能包含学生的姓名、年龄、性别、班级等几个基本属性,而一个订单表可能包含订单号、客户姓名、产品名称、数量、价格等多个属性。
-
数据库管理系统(DBMS)通常有一定的限制,限制表中列的数目。例如,某些DBMS可能限制每个表的列数目不能超过1000个。超出这个限制可能会导致性能下降或其他问题。
-
数据库表的列数目也会影响查询和数据操作的效率。如果表中包含过多的列,查询和数据操作可能会变得更加复杂和耗时。因此,在设计数据库表时,需要权衡表的复杂性和查询效率之间的平衡。
-
数据库列数目的变化是可能的。随着业务需求的变化,可能需要添加新的列或删除现有的列。在这种情况下,需要进行适当的数据迁移和表结构的修改,以确保数据的一致性和完整性。
总之,数据库列的数目是根据具体需求和表设计而定的,可以是任意数量。合理设计和管理数据库表的列数目对于数据的存储和查询是非常重要的。
1年前 -
-
数据库列的数目是指数据库表中的列的数量。每个数据库表都由一系列列组成,每列都有一个唯一的名称和数据类型。列是用来存储表中的数据的,每个列都对应着表中的一个属性或特征。数据库列的数目取决于表的设计和需求,可以根据具体的业务需求来确定表中需要的列数目。
在设计数据库表时,需要根据业务需求确定所需的列数目,并为每个列指定一个合适的名称和数据类型。常见的数据类型包括整型、浮点型、字符型、日期型等。根据不同的业务需求,可能需要添加不同类型的列来存储不同的数据。
数据库列的数目对于数据库的性能和效率也有一定的影响。如果表中的列过多,可能会导致查询和操作的效率下降,因为数据库需要处理更多的数据。因此,在设计数据库表时,需要合理地选择所需的列数目,避免过多或过少的列,以提高数据库的性能和效率。
总而言之,数据库列的数目是指数据库表中的列的数量,根据业务需求进行设计,并且需要合理选择列的数目以提高数据库的性能和效率。
1年前 -
数据库列的数目是指数据库表中的列的数量。每个数据库表都由若干列组成,每一列都有一个唯一的名称和特定的数据类型。列是数据库表中存储数据的基本单位,它们描述了表中的每个数据字段的属性。
在数据库设计和管理中,确定数据库表中的列数非常重要。这决定了表的结构和数据存储方式。在设计数据库表时,需要根据实际需求确定所需的列数。一般来说,列的数目取决于数据的种类和属性,以及表的功能和目的。
以下是确定数据库列数的一般步骤和操作流程:
-
分析需求:首先,需要明确数据库表的功能和目的。了解需要存储的数据种类和属性,以及数据之间的关系。
-
设计表结构:根据需求分析的结果,设计数据库表的结构。确定表的名称、列的名称、数据类型和约束等。
-
添加列:根据表的设计,添加所需的列。可以使用数据库管理工具,如MySQL Workbench、Oracle SQL Developer等来执行DDL(数据定义语言)操作,创建表并添加列。
-
定义列属性:为每个列定义特定的属性。这包括数据类型、长度、精度、约束条件等。根据需要,可以设置列为主键、外键、唯一键或非空等。
-
设置默认值:为列设置默认值,以便在插入新记录时,如果没有指定该列的值,则使用默认值。
-
编辑列:如果需要修改已存在的列,可以使用ALTER TABLE语句来编辑列的属性。可以修改列的数据类型、长度、约束条件等。
-
删除列:如果某个列不再需要,可以使用ALTER TABLE语句来删除列。注意,删除列会删除该列中的所有数据。
-
调整列的顺序:如果需要调整列的顺序,可以使用ALTER TABLE语句来修改表的结构,重新定义列的顺序。
总结:数据库列的数目取决于具体的需求和设计。在设计数据库表时,需要根据需求分析确定所需的列数,并根据表的功能和目的进行设计和管理。通过使用数据库管理工具和DDL语句,可以添加、编辑、删除和调整列的属性和顺序。
1年前 -